fix: strip MarkdownV2 italic markers in Telegram plaintext fallback

When MarkdownV2 parsing fails, _strip_mdv2() removes escape backslashes
and bold markers (*text*) but missed italic markers (_text_). Users saw
raw underscores around italic text in the plaintext fallback.

- Add regex to strip _text_ italic markers in _strip_mdv2()
- Use word boundary lookaround to preserve snake_case identifiers
- Add tests for _strip_mdv2 covering italic, bold, snake_case, and edge cases

@ -86,6 +86,9 @@ def _strip_mdv2(text: str) -> str:
cleaned = re.sub(r'\\([_*\[\]()~`>#\+\-=|{}.!\\])', r'\1', text)
# Remove MarkdownV2 bold markers that format_message converted from **bold**
cleaned = re.sub(r'\*([^*]+)\*', r'\1', cleaned)
# Remove MarkdownV2 italic markers that format_message converted from *italic*
# Use word boundary (\b) to avoid breaking snake_case like my_variable_name
cleaned = re.sub(r'(?<!\w)_([^_]+)_(?!\w)', r'\1', cleaned)
return cleaned
